百分点

bǎi fēn diǎn

percentage point

HSK Level 6

Example Sentences

中国经济增长率在过去十年中提高了5个百分点。

Zhōngguó jīngjì zēngzhǎng lǜ zài guòqù shí nián zhōng tígāo le 5 gè bǎifēndiǎn.

China's economic growth rate has increased by 5 percentage points in the past decade.

失业率下降了2个百分点。

Shīyè lǜ xiàngdiǎo le 2 gè bǎifēndiǎn.

The unemployment rate has dropped by 2 percentage points.

通货膨胀率上升了1个百分点。

Tōnghuò péngzhàng lǜ shàngshēng le 1 gè bǎifēndiǎn.

The inflation rate has gone up by 1 percentage point.

Etymology & Components

The Chinese word 百分点 (bǎifēndiǎn) is a compound of three characters: 百 (bǎi), meaning "hundred"; 分 (fēn), meaning "part" or "percentage"; and 点 (diǎn), meaning "point". Together, these characters literally mean "hundred percentage point".The term 百分点 is used in Chinese to refer to a percentage point, which is a unit of measurement used to express the relative change in a percentage.
